Navigating the Workplace in the Age of AI

Published by edX

The report explores the rapid rise of AI and its impact on the workforce, revealing that nearly half of today's skills may become obsolete by 2025. It emphasizes the need for executives and employees alike to adapt by developing AI-related skills. The findings highlight gaps in learning and development programs, with many employees feeling unprepared and considering leaving for better opportunities. Additionally, AI is reshaping roles across all levels, from entry-level positions to the C-Suite, with automation expected to affect numerous functions, including leadership roles.
